The first with plain barrel, flat bevelled English lock (action defective, cock and steel old replacements) with roller and engraved with a martial trophy on the stepped tail, silver full stock cast and chased with foliate scrollwork in low relief overall highlighted with small nielloed panels, curved butt with bulbous pommel and foliate finial, and muzzle-sleeve with false ramrod decorated en suite, later plain silver trigger-guard, and trigger cast as a human figure (steel parts with some rust patination); the second each of characteristic form, with iron barrels each retained by a brass barrel band, plain locks (one incomplete), wooden full stocks and butts with spurred pommels (one cap missing) entirely covered in engraved brass (some damage) secured by pins and decorated along the backs of the butts with pewter clusters, iron trigger-guards, and iron ramrods (both worn and rust patinated overall) (3) The first 31 cm. barrel
